Zheng Liang was paralyzed below his chest.

Zheng Liang was once a Chinese men's volleyball player, 2 meters 01 tall and excellent jumping ability, he once helped the Chinese men's volleyball team win two Asian Championship championships and an Asian Games championship, is the team's history of the gold medal secondary attack.

But since 2016, he has been suffering from spinal cord lesions, and now he has no consciousness below the chest, and he cannot do without the help of nurses every day, except for rehabilitation training, he can only stay in bed for a long time.

In order to raise funds for the treatment of the disease, he recently launched a crowdfunding project on the online platform, which was enthusiastically helped by the outside world. In an interview with the surging news reporter, Zheng Liang said that he was very grateful, "There are always many good people and warm-hearted people. ”

At the same time, in addition to the sick salary, he is also trying to make money through online live broadcasting, "also trying to do this, to see if he can do it." ”

Treatment costs are high, and crowdfunding is used to treat diseases

After retiring from the army, from 2016, Zheng Liang occasionally felt some numbness in his legs, and after entering 2017, his condition became more and more serious, and then he completely lost the consciousness of his lower limbs, except for rehabilitation training, he could only stay in bed most of the time.

After seeing a doctor, the doctor gave the diagnosis of spinal cord lesions.

With the passage of time, Zheng Liang's condition has not been fundamentally improved. He told the surging news reporter that in 2019, he was unconscious below the navel, but now he is paralyzed below the chest.

In order to treat his illness, in addition to the hospital in his hometown of Hangzhou, he has also visited many large hospitals in other cities and authoritative hospitals in the industry, but there is no particularly good cure.

More than a month ago, a hospital in Ningxia took the initiative to contact him and expressed its willingness to provide treatment for him, and he has been treated in Yinchuan for more than a month.

Zheng Liang revealed that the hospital is very small in scale and does not have the conditions for rehabilitation training, but after more than a month of treatment, he feels that his physical condition is good, "for example, there was no taste at eating before, and now there is a sense of taste, and the mental state is much better than when he came." ”

"One of the directors here told me after the examination that my spinal condition had gone down a phase (worsening upwards) and had dropped by two to three centimeters. This disease wants to be able to sit up at once, and it is not realistic to be able to walk, it must be a very long process. ”

The hospital offered to provide the first two courses of treatment (one course a month) free of charge, but from the third course onwards, it cost a lot, requiring 2,000 yuan per day for treatment, not including part of the cost of drugs.

Originally, Zheng Liang planned to return to Hangzhou once after two courses of treatment, but at present, due to the relationship between the epidemic and the long-distance trek, it is already very hard for him, so he can only "take one step at a time" at present.

Thanks to the help of the outside world, he is also working hard

A few days ago, Zheng Liang launched a crowdfunding project on the online platform.

In the fact sheet, he wrote that his follow-up treatment fees, nursing fees, etc. still need more than one million yuan, "all the savings and support of relatives and friends in the past have been spent, and some debts are still owed, and now they only rely on about 6,000 yuan per month of sick return wages to survive." ”

"What I need to explain to you is that my current situation is caused by illness, not by injuries in training matches, and if the latter is caused by injuries, the country is a package to the end, and vice versa, it is my personal burden."

Previously, the General Administration of Sport's Management Center, the Zhejiang Sports Vocational and Technical College where Zheng Liang worked, and the relevant management departments in Hangzhou have all provided Zheng Liang with financial assistance and other aspects.

In addition, the public welfare foundation established by the former mentor Wang Jiawei and the Olympic champion Gao Min and the fund of the female ranking general Hui Ruoqi have also raised donations to Zheng Liang. In addition, Zheng Liang's brother and the Chinese basketball celebrity Zheng Wu's family also helped Zheng Liang a lot.

Zheng Liang is very grateful for the help of the outside world, "In the end, there are many good people and warm-hearted people." But even so, he wants to do as much as he can.

Zheng Liang started live broadcasting.

At present, he has opened an account on the online video platform, shared a lot of videos about the positive energy of his life, and at the same time, he is also live streaming on the Internet, sharing his life experience with everyone, and also hopes to increase some income through the way of "live streaming with goods".

"Usually, a lot of difficult brothers and sisters-in-law will help me, but I don't want to bother my brothers and sisters-in-law for a long time." I am also trying to do this (live broadcast) to see if I can do it. ”

"But the income is also a drop in the bucket, the key is that I can't move, there is no special assistant or the like, if there is, it may earn a little more, but there is no way at present."

But even so, Zheng Liang will not give up his efforts, "My efforts are seen by everyone, and it is precisely because of my efforts that everyone will pay attention to me." ”

Just four days after the release of the crowdfunding, as of the surging news reporter's press release, Zheng Liang's fundraising project has received nearly 4,000 people's support, raising nearly 300,000 yuan.
